Unveil the secrets of Europe’s oldest capital! Explore its iconic cultural treasures and embark on a journey through the ages of the Bulgarian capital’s rich history!Wander through Sofia’s charming streets, where ancient ruins meet modern vibrancy. Visit the stunning Alexander Nevsky Cathedral, a masterpiece of Neo-Byzantine architecture, and marvel at its golden domes that glimmer in the sunlight. Delve into the past at the National Institute of Archaeology with Museum, where artifacts from Thracian, Roman, and Byzantine times tell tales of bygone eras.
Don’t miss the ancient Serdica complex, where you can walk amidst the remnants of Roman streets and buildings, feeling the pulse of history beneath your feet. Stroll through the lush National theater park, a green oasis in the heart of the city, offering a perfect spot for relaxation and reflection.
